C#


Overcome Common Threading Problems

Create a class that addresses common threading problems and overcome cross-thread calling and resource protection issues.

Resources for VSTS and TFS

Check out these publications, tools, and community sites for additional information about Visual Studio Team System and Team Foundation Server.

Prepare for WPF Properly

WPF is going to change the way you write graphics applications, but it''s going to take a while before you see it adopted broadly.

New MS Forefront Tools Improve Security

Microsoft's new Forefront products and Vista security enhancements were highlighted at this week's TechEd keynote.

New Technology Offers Dev Challenges, UI Improvements

Developers who work on the UI side of advanced apps must learn new technology for forms-based dev to improve the user experience.

Get Ready for WSS v3 and MOSS 2007

WPF is going to change the way you write graphics applications, but it's going to take a while before you see it adopted broadly.

Top Visual Studio Products Honored

VSM presented its annual Readers Choice Awards to the Visual Studio vendor community.

Realize New Functionality in .NET 3.0

The .NET Framework 3.0 represents a major set of functionality in .NET, and yet doesn't change any existing .NET Framework 2.0 libraries, compilers, or features.

BCGControlBar Library Version 8.6, More

From libraries to encryption, from refactoring to imaging, debugging, and lifecycle management—don't let anyone tell you there's not a rich selection of third-party tools awaiting.

Validate Business Objects Declaratively

Take advantage of .NET attributes to provide robust validation for your business objects, while generating user-interface validation automatically.

I Like VB6

A reader explains that he likes VB6, and that is enough; another reader comments on the disconnect between Bill Gates' charitable work and Microsoft's (and other companies') assistance to the Chinese government in helping it stifle dissent.

Inside C# 3.0: Extension Methods, Query Expressions, and Expression Trees

Move beyond the techno-speak, and learn how you can leverage new features in C# 3.0.

IP*Works: Simplify Internet Development

Take advantage of /n software's IP*Works to simplify a variety of Internet-related tasks, from working with SOAP, to handling tasks related to HTTP, DNS, and FTP seamlessly.

Use VSTS for Advanced Testing

Get an overview of Visual Studio 2005 Team Edition for Software Testers and its Unit Testing Framework, Test Case Management, and Advanced Load Testing tools.

Build Better Collections With Generics

Take advantage of .NET 2.0's addition of generics to provide better collections functionality in your applications.

Understand Variable Scoping and Definite Assignment

Learn how to scope your variables correctly, as well as the rules governing definite assignment in C#.

SQL Server Resources

Check out these publications, tools, SDKs, and community sites for additional information about SQL Server.

Save Time With LINQ Queries

See how the LINQ syntax, specifically DLinq and XLinq, can increase your productivity and reduce the possibility for error.

Best Practices for Testing and Debugging Managed Code

Visual Studio 2005 Team Edition for Software Developers features a built-in Unit Testing system that lets you define unit tests before you start programming and rerun your tests whenever you wish.

Requirements Patterns With VSTS

Learn some simple yet powerful requirements patterns that you can apply to most projects and processes.

Subscribe on YouTube

Upcoming Training Events